Shiba Predator (QOM) 是一种加密货币,于2022推出。 QOM 的当前供应量为 599,886.33Bn,其中 599,886.33Bn 正在流通。 QOM 的最新已知价格为 0.000000001649 USD,过去 24 小时内的价格为 -0.000000000004。目前在 个活跃市场上进行交易,过去 24 小时内的交易量为 $0。更多信息可以在http://qompredator.finance/找到。

Market News | Jefferies Says the First Hike Is About Credibility and the Rest Depend on the War
Market News | Jefferies Says the First Hike Is About Credibility and the Rest Depend on the War
Jefferies global economist Mohit Kumar expects the Federal Reserve to raise rates this week, with Chair Kevin Warsh's commentary carrying more weight than the decision itself."We expect the Fed to raise rates, but Warsh's comments on the future direction of policy will be crucial," Kumar said in a report.On the path beyond September, Jefferies expects the Fed to deliver fewer than the 3.5 hikes markets currently price over the longer term.The Distinction Between the First Hike and the RestKumar's framing separates two different decisions that markets have been treating as one."From a credibility standpoint, the first rate hike may be necessary, but subsequent rate hikes will depend on how long the war lasts and the trend of oil prices," he said.That reads the September move as a response to market pressure rather than to the data alone. Risk Dimensions CIO Mark Connors described the same dynamic last week: "The market has now challenged both sides of policy. Bessent went first. Even tripling Treasury buybacks hasn't tamed the long end. Now, Warsh, after talking disinflation, is being forced towards higher rates."A credibility hike and an inflation-fighting cycle are different things. The first establishes that the Fed will act when pressed. The second requires a judgment that inflation is embedded rather than imported.Subsequent Moves Depend on a Variable the Fed Cannot ForecastThe condition Kumar attaches to further tightening is the notable part.Tying the path to the war's duration and oil prices makes policy contingent on a geopolitical variable outside the Fed's information set. Central banks can model labour markets and credit conditions. They cannot model whether Saudi Arabia reopens the East-West pipeline.That pipeline closure is the specific supply constraint. It runs from the Eastern Province oil fields to the Red Sea port of Yanbu and exists to provide an export route bypassing the Strait of Hormuz. With Hormuz disrupted and the bypass shut, Saudi crude has no unconstrained path to market — production fell 1.9 million barrels per day to 6.238 million, the lowest since 1990.Brent closed at $104.61, up more than 8% on the week. If that resolves, the inflation impulse driving the tightening case resolves with it.Markets Price 3.5 Hikes, Forecasters Are LowerThe gap between market pricing and house forecasts is wide enough to matter.Markets price roughly 3.5 hikes long term, equivalent to about 87.5 basis points. Bank of America expects 25 basis points this week with another 50 by year-end. RBC Capital Markets revised from rate cuts to three hikes. Both land at 75 basis points.Jefferies sits below all of them.The convergence of independent forecasters beneath market pricing suggests the futures curve is carrying a hedging premium rather than a central expectation. Traders flipped from assuming no hikes for the remainder of 2026 to hedging as much as 75 basis points in the two weeks since Jackson Hole — a repositioning that scale tends to overshoot.Warsh Has to Provide Guidance He Rejects as a PracticeThe bind Kumar identifies is structural rather than tactical.Warsh used Jackson Hole to reject forward guidance, arguing the practice has "overstayed its welcome" outside genuine crises and committing to "a discipline, not to a decision." The Wall Street Journal's Nick Timiraos identified the consequence: the speech convinced investors a hike was likelier without specifying what would trigger one, leaving markets to fill the gap themselves.They filled it with 75 to 87.5 basis points.Wednesday's press conference asks him to correct that without doing the thing he says corrupts policymaking. Saying nothing leaves the overshoot in place. Saying enough to reset expectations is forward guidance by another name.The dot plot and updated projections do some of that work impersonally, which may be the intended route.The Decision Itself Is Near-Fully PricedThe two-year Treasury yield reached 4.61% after Friday's CPI as traders assigned nearly a 100% chance of a move, having risen from 4.20% before Jackson Hole.Core CPI rose 0.3% against 0.2% expected. Headline came in at 0.4% monthly and 3.4% annually, both in line, with core at 2.4% year-over-year.The 10-year held flat at 4.95%, which is the detail supporting Kumar's view. A market pricing an embedded inflation problem would push long yields higher alongside short ones. A flat 10-year alongside a rising two-year says the market reads the energy shock as a level shift and the Fed's response as adequate.LMAX Group's Joel Kruger flagged what near-certain pricing implies: "We see greater potential for an outsized move in risk assets to the topside should the Fed ultimately fail to deliver on these hawkish expectations."Two Events Land Before the DecisionBitcoin traded around $77,300 after Friday's release, having reached $82,284 last week and dipped to $76,046 in the hours before CPI.Glassnode data shows nearly 8% of supply was acquired between $80,000 and $82,000, with the US spot ETF cohort's average cost basis in the same band and the 50-week moving average at $81,081. CryptoQuant's spot demand metric sits at −145,000 BTC after nearly turning positive in late August.The Clarity Act cloture vote falls Tuesday, requiring 60 votes to advance a bill Democrats have continued to flag over the absent ethics agreement. The Fed decides Wednesday at 2:00 p.m. ET with projections and the press conference following.
